Output 305b59d2accf2d4423732dfe2c00aab2e0725b899a406cc794eb4a3fbff4362e:0

value
8297514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c3d64d12eb3138ebb6d7e7055ab8f59aedeae18 OP_EQUAL
address
3BZLSyiKqYHgZ6C1x3xE65UWTo65Lmcz5H
transaction
305b59d2accf2d4423732dfe2c00aab2e0725b899a406cc794eb4a3fbff4362e
confirmations
191506
spent
true